回显服务器是什么问题

fiy 其他 13

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    回显服务器是用于检测网络连接和诊断问题的一种工具。它的作用是将接收到的数据发送回给发送者,用于确认数据是否成功发送或接收。回显服务器通常是在网络上架设的一台服务器,可以被任何设备访问。

    回显服务器的工作原理是接收发送者发送的数据包,然后将接收到的数据包原封不动地发送回给发送者。通过接收回显数据包,发送者可以确认数据是否被成功传输,并检查是否有任何数据包丢失、延迟或损坏的问题。

    回显服务器对于网络故障排除非常有用。当网络连接出现问题时,可以通过向回显服务器发送数据包并等待回显响应来确定问题的根源。如果接收到的回显响应与发送的数据包相匹配,则可以排除发送者端的问题;如果没有收到回显响应或者回显响应与发送的数据包不匹配,那么可能存在网络连接故障或其他问题。

    在网络安全领域中,回显服务器也可以用于执行一些安全测试,如检测网络中的漏洞或进行拒绝服务攻击测试。回显服务器可以模拟发送大量的请求,以验证网络设备或服务器能否正常处理高负载和异常流量情况。

    总的来说,回显服务器是一种用于检测网络连接和诊断问题的工具,它对于排除网络故障和执行安全测试非常有用。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    回显服务器(Echo server)是一种网络服务器程序,其主要功能是将它收到的数据包原封不动地返回给发送者。这意味着,当客户端发送一条消息到回显服务器时,服务器会将这条消息原样返回给客户端,而不做任何修改或处理。

    以下是关于回显服务器的五个问题的解答:

    1. 回显服务器的用途是什么?
      回显服务器主要用于网络通信的测试和调试。通过向回显服务器发送数据包,并验证返回的数据包是否与发送的完全相同,可以检查网络连接是否正常,数据是否传输准确等。它可以帮助开发人员诊断问题,定位错误,并进行网络协议的测试和验证。

    2. 回显服务器如何工作?
      回显服务器通常采用Socket编程实现,使用TCP或UDP协议进行数据传输。当客户端连接到回显服务器后,服务器会创建一个套接字并监听指定端口。当接收到客户端发送的数据包后,服务器会将该数据包原封不动地返回给客户端。

    3. 回显服务器有哪些应用场景?
      回显服务器广泛应用于网络调试和测试领域。例如,在开发网络应用程序时,可以通过连接回显服务器来验证和测试网络通信的正确性。此外,回显服务器还可以用于检查网络连接的稳定性、带宽测试等。

    4. 回显服务器的优缺点是什么?
      回显服务器的优点是简单易用,实现成本较低。它可以快速验证网络连接是否正常,用于调试和测试网络应用程序非常方便。然而,回显服务器只能验证网络连接的基本功能,无法模拟真实世界的复杂场景和行为,因此在一些特殊情况下可能无法提供准确的测试结果。

    5. 回显服务器与黑客攻击有关吗?
      回显服务器本身不涉及黑客攻击,它只是一个简单的网络通信工具。然而,回显服务器在一些情况下可能被滥用为DDoS攻击的一部分。攻击者可以将回显服务器作为中继站点,将大量伪造的数据包发送给回显服务器,然后通过回显服务器来放大攻击流量。因此,回显服务器的安全性也需要得到关注和保护。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    回显服务器是指在网络渗透测试或系统安全测试中,利用某些漏洞或特定的命令,向目标主机发送请求,并通过接收到的响应报文来获取目标系统的信息。通常情况下,回显服务器用于验证目标主机是否存在漏洞,或者获取目标主机的操作系统、服务版本等敏感信息。然而,回显服务器也可能会被黑客用来进行恶意攻击,所以在实际应用中需要谨慎使用。

    以下是回显服务器的一般操作流程:

    1. 确定目标:首先要选择合适的目标主机进行测试。可以是一个网站、服务器或其他网络设备。

    2. 扫描目标:使用网络扫描工具,如Nmap、Zmap等,对目标主机进行端口扫描,查找可能存在的漏洞或开放的端口。

    3. 响应验证:根据扫描结果,确定目标主机可能存在的漏洞或可利用的应用程序。根据具体目标,选择合适的方法对目标主机进行验证。

    4. 构建回显服务器:根据目标主机的漏洞特点或需要获取的信息,选择合适的回显服务器工具。常用的回显服务器工具有Netcat、Python SimpleHTTPServer等。根据工具的使用说明,进行配置和启动。

    5. 发送请求: 使用命令或脚本,向目标主机发送请求。请求可以是针对某个特定漏洞的利用请求,也可以是一些常见命令,如Ping、nslookup等,来验证目标主机的状态或获取目标系统的信息。

    6. 接收响应:回显服务器工具会监听指定端口,当接收到目标主机的响应时,可以查看响应报文或记录下相关信息。响应报文可能包含目标主机的操作系统、服务版本等敏感信息。

    7. 分析结果:根据接收到的响应,分析目标主机的漏洞情况或敏感信息。如果发现目标主机存在漏洞,需要及时报告给相关人员并修复漏洞。

    8. 清理工作:结束后,需要关闭回显服务器,删除相关的日志文件和痕迹,确保不留下任何漏洞信息或攻击痕迹。

    需要注意的是,在进行回显服务器测试时,应遵守相关法律法规,并确保测试的合法性与安全性。在未经授权的情况下,进行回显服务器测试是非法的,并且可能涉及到未授权访问、侵犯隐私等违法行为。所以在实施前,务必获得目标主机的所有者的书面授权。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部